I'm assuming we are talking "prep" for survival on an event that hasn't happened yet?

 

So we can still purchase guns, ammo, etc. at today's prices and availability?

 

I do a lot of business with Palmetto State Armory; so I didn't bother to check any other sources.

 

$1200.00

(And I just verified all these prices as accurate and the firearms available).

 

PSA Dagger Compact 9mm

$299.00

Glock 19 "clone" that, in many ways, is superior to the Glock and I would not hesitate to trust my life to one (just bought one for Desert Scorpion for a new carry gun).

 

PSA AR-15 clone flat top 5.56 

$399.00

We all know what AR clones are - (at the price) I have been very impressed with what I have seen from PSA.

 

Maverick 88 12ga. Pump Shotgun. $250.00

For those who don't know - Maverick is Mossbergs "budget" brand, comparable to a mdl. 500.

 

$950 for 3 NEW firearms.

A concealed carry pistol, long range defensive rifle and a close range shotgun.

Leaving $250 for ammo, holster, slings.

 

It can certainly be done and with decent quality firearms with respectable capability.
